A digital micro-mirror device (DMD) acting as a real-time holo-gram is an emerging technology in dynamic holographic projection. Thispaper presents a lensless image magnification method in DMD hologra-phy by using a Fresnel hologram. By analyzing the diffraction order dis-tribution in the image plane of a hologram produced by DMD, we find thefactors that limit the size of the magnified image. We perform a lenslessmagnification experiment that shows good magnified images in accor-dance with the numerical results. Finally, we discuss methods to eliminatelongitudinal error and chromatic aberration in three-dimensional (3-D) andcolor projection, respectively, and present a 3-D image reconstructionresult that shows lensless magnification of a 3-D image without distortion.Itisbelievedthatthistechniquecanbeusedinfuturereal-timeholographicprojection based on digital light processing technology.
